POLYURETHANE RESIN COMPOSITION, REPELLENT, WATER REPELLENT FOR FIBERS, AND STAIN-PROOF COATING AGENT

A polyurethane resin composition includes a reaction product of an aliphatic polyisocyanate derivative having an average number of isocyanate groups of 2 or more; a long-chain active hydrogen compound including a hydrocarbon group having 12 or more and 30 or less carbon atoms and an active hydrogen group in combination; a cationic active hydrogen compound including an active hydrogen group and a cationic group in combination; and an acid compound capable of a salt with the cationic group. The concentration of the hydrocarbon group is 30% or more and 85% or less.

MULTIFUNCTIONAL HYDROPHOBIC SURFACE COATINGS FOR INTERIOR APPLICATIONS
20230041184 · 2023-02-09 ·

Disclosed are multifunctional coating compositions for surface coating substrates, for instance interior surfaces in aircraft. In embodiments, the coating compositions include a binder system, such as a resin or solvent, including from 10 to 15% by volume of the coating composition, a hydrophobic polymer including from 40 to 80% by volume of the coating composition, and montmorillonite clay particles comprising from 0.1 to 5% by volume of the coating composition, the montmorillonite clay particles having a particle diameter from 1 to 25 microns. In some embodiments, the coating composition includes an antimicrobial agent. Also disclosed are methods for surface coating a substrate with a multifunctional coating composition.

Optical film

The present invention provides a method for producing an optical film excellent in anti-fouling properties and scratch resistance as well as anti-reflection properties. The method includes the steps of: (1) applying a lower layer resin and an upper layer resin; (2) forming a resin layer having the uneven structure on a surface thereof by pressing a mold against the lower layer resin and the upper layer resin from the upper layer resin side in the state where the applied lower layer resin and upper layer resin are stacked; and (3) curing the resin layer, the lower layer resin containing at least one kind of first monomer that contains no fluorine atoms, the upper layer resin containing a fluorine-containing monomer and at least one kind of second monomer that contains no fluorine atoms, at least one of the first monomer and the second monomer containing a compatible monomer that is compatible with the fluorine-containing monomer and being dissolved in the lower layer resin and the upper layer resin.

COATING COMPOSITION AND METHOD FOR FORMING COATING FILM
20230015961 · 2023-01-19 ·

An object is to providing a coating composition for attaining excellent storage stability of a coating material, excellent stain resistance (a property of preventing stains from adhering or a property of removing stains) of a coating film, and excellent durability of stain resistance of the coating film, and excellent scratch resistance of the coating film, and having transparency, and protecting the appearance for a long period of time, as well as a method of forming the coating film of the same. As a solution, provided is a coating composition comprising a silyl group-containing acrylic resin (A), a silyl group-free acrylic resin containing hydroxyl group (B), a polyisocyanate compound (C), and a catalyst (D), wherein the silyl group-containing acrylic resin (A) includes at least one polydimethyl siloxane segment.

PRECURSOR POLYELECTROLYTE COMPLEXES COMPOSITIONS

The invention relates to compositions and methods of treatment employing compositions comprising polyelectrolyte complexes. The compositions include a water-soluble first polyelectrolyte bearing a net cationic charge or capable of developing a net cationic charge and a water-soluble second polyelectrolyte bearing a net anionic charge or capable of developing a net anionic charge. The total polyelectrolyte concentration of the first solution is at least 110 millimolar. The composition is free of coacervates, precipitates, latex particles, synthetic block copolymers, silicone copolymers, cross-linked poly(acrylic) and cross-linked water-soluble polyelectrolyte. The composition may be a concentrate, to be diluted prior to use to treat a surface.
